A homozygous splice-site variant in SAMHD1 shows variable expressivity of Aicardi-Goutières syndrome type 5: a case report and literature review

BackgroundAicardi-Goutières syndrome type 5 (AGS5) is a rare pediatric-onset monogenic interferonopathy caused by loss-of-function variants in the SAMHD1 gene.
